Excavations by the Metropolitan Museum at a necropolis in Egypt's Libyan Desert revealed a domed funerary chapel with an intriguing form of decoration: glass vessels of various shapes and colors impressed into the plaster of the dome. These fragments come from a shallow bowl made of greenish-clear glass with a molded decoration of concentric circles within a checkerboard.
